Connector structure and connector type terminal block structure
Abstract
A connector structure that can ensure connection is provided. In the connector structure, a bus bar and a plate-like terminal mate with each other to establish an electric connection. A lower-side inner surface as a first inner surface defining the opening is provided with a plurality of conductive rotary members that rotate in a direction substantially perpendicular to a direction in which the plate-like terminal is inserted. It is also provided with a frame member that holds the rotary members and that is connected to the bus bar. The rotary members are twisted relative to the frame member and thereby biased relative to the plate-like terminal. By the plate-like terminal being inserted into and pulled out from the bus bar, the rotary members receive force from the plate-like terminal and rotate within a plane substantially perpendicular to a direction in which the plate-like terminal is inserted and pulled out.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A connector structure, comprising:
a first connector component; and
a second connector component mating with said first connector component to ensure an electric connection, wherein
an opening into which said second connector component is inserted is formed at said first connector component,
a first inner surface defining said opening is provided with a plurality of conductive rotary members that abut on said second connector component and that rotate in a direction substantially perpendicular to a direction in which said second connector component is inserted, and a frame member that holds said rotary members and that is connected to said first connector component,
said rotary members are twisted relative to said frame member and thereby biased relative to said second connector component,
by said second connector component being inserted into and pulled out from said first connector component, said rotary members receive force from said second connector component and rotate within a plane substantially perpendicular to a direction in which said second connector component is inserted and pulled out, and
said frame member and said rotary members are formed from working of a common conductive plate;
wherein a tip portion of each of said rotary members is provided with a tilt surface that is tilted relative to a direction in which said second connector component is inserted into said first connector component.
2. The connector structure according to claim 1 , wherein
said opening is defined by a second inner surface opposing to said first inner surface,
said first inner surface is provided with a plurality of first protrusions, wherein one of the first protrusions is provided forward of the rotary members and another of the first protrusions is provided backward of the rotary members with respect to a direction of insertion of said second connector component, whereby abutment on said second connector component is enabled, and
said second inner surface is provided with a second protrusion between said plurality of first protrusions that can abut on said second connector component.
3. A connector type terminal block structure, comprising:
a base member holding the connector structure according to claim 1 ;
a stator terminal fixed to said base member with said first connector component; and
a fixing member fixing said stator terminal and said first connector component to said base member.
4. The connector type terminal block structure according to claim 3 , further comprising
a terminal cover mounted to said base member to store said connector terminal.
5. The connector structure according to claim 1 , wherein the one of the first protrusions and the other of the first protrusions extends in a direction perpendicular to the direction of insertion of said second connector component.Cited by (0)
